The number of user-created filters has reached 4000. All filters are seamlessly tiled, resolution independent, and support real-world HDRI lighting, which makes them immediately useful for computer artists and game developers. The Filter Library is available at http://www.filterforge.com/filters/

About Filter Forge – This high-end plugin for Adobe Photoshop allows computer artists to build their own filters – seamless textures, visual effects, distortions, patterns, backgrounds, frames and more. Filter Forge can be downloaded at http://www.filterforge.com/download/

About Filter Forge, Inc. – Based in Alexandria, VA, Filter Forge, Inc. is a one-product company solely focused on developing Filter Forge, an innovative Photoshop plugin allowing its users to create their own filters. For more information, visit http://www.filterforge.com
